Output 4016e8ae331a01f86dc87dc157f9f904b2739b666d6e326f091f87645a20dfab:0

value
620493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66dfbe2501dc0127a4dba477961464d0a1589f00 OP_EQUAL
address
3B4xt2fDDnXcyfJTogJ6CM98vwG4FtTyu2
transaction
4016e8ae331a01f86dc87dc157f9f904b2739b666d6e326f091f87645a20dfab
spent
true